The cost of screening, buffing, and re-capping hardwood floors is between $1.75 and $3.50 per square ft. Screening uses a fine buffing disc to remove the old finish without sanding the wood underneath. Vacuum after each sanding to pick up coarse grit left on the floor. Sweep or vacuum the floor before you move up to the next grit. Even the best abrasives throw off a few granules while sanding. And a 36-grit granule caught under a 60-grit belt will leave an ugly gash in the floor.How much does it cost to refinish hardwood floors? Screening and recoating involves scuffing the finish of your hardwoods with a floor buffer, and then applying a new top coat. This process does not require sanding down to raw wood and removing part of the floors wear layer. Solid hardwood floors should have about ¾ inch of veneer left to safely refinish them. Or, sometimes this is measured the number of times that your hardwood floors have already been refinished, with 6 or 7 iterations being the generally accepted ...On average, it costs $1,870 to refinish hardwood floors.
